The Costly Inefficiency of Paper-Based Trade

Global trade finance remains anchored in the 20th century, with paper-based processes creating a massive drag on efficiency and profitability. This section details the tangible costs of legacy systems and how blockchain offers a direct path to operational compression.

The foundational pain point is the sheer volume of paper. A single international shipment can generate over 100 pages of documents—bills of lading, letters of credit, certificates of origin, and invoices. Each document must be physically couriered, manually checked for discrepancies, and reconciled across dozens of parties. This process is not just slow; it's a significant cost center. The manual labor for data entry, the fees for couriers and bank document handling, and the cost of storage and retrieval for compliance audits add millions in overhead annually for large enterprises.

Beyond direct costs, the opacity and friction of paper chains create severe working capital constraints. Goods can sit idle at ports for weeks awaiting the correct paperwork, incurring demurrage charges and delaying revenue recognition. Discrepancies in documents, which occur in over 50% of transactions, trigger time-consuming and expensive resolution processes. This inefficiency ties up capital, increases risk, and destroys the agility needed in modern supply chains. The business outcome is a bloated cost structure and a competitive disadvantage.

The blockchain fix replaces paper with immutable digital twins of trade documents on a shared ledger. A smart contract can automate the entire letter of credit process: triggering payment automatically upon the digital receipt of a verified bill of lading and customs clearance. This eliminates manual checks, reduces discrepancies to near zero, and compresses settlement from weeks to hours. The ROI is quantifiable: reduction in document processing costs by 50-80%, acceleration of cash flow cycles, and the elimination of fraud-related losses. It's not about new technology for its own sake; it's about surgically removing the most expensive and error-prone steps in a centuries-old process.

The Blockchain Fix: A Single, Immutable Source of Truth

Discover how a shared, tamper-proof ledger eliminates costly reconciliation, dispute resolution, and manual data verification, directly compressing operational overhead.

The foundational pain point is data silos and reconciliation. In complex supply chains or multi-party finance, each participant maintains their own ledger. A single shipment or transaction can generate dozens of conflicting records—invoices, bills of lading, customs forms, and payment confirmations. Reconciling these disparate systems is a manual, error-prone, and expensive process, often requiring dedicated teams and weeks of effort. This operational friction is a pure cost center with no value-add, draining resources that could be directed toward innovation.

Blockchain introduces a single, immutable source of truth. All authorized participants write to and read from the same shared ledger. When a shipment is recorded or a payment is initiated, that event is cryptographically sealed and visible to all parties in near real-time. This eliminates the 'he-said-she-said' dynamic and the need for constant data matching. The result is a dramatic reduction in administrative overhead, fewer errors, and the near-elimination of costly disputes over basic facts. The ledger itself becomes the trusted arbiter.

The direct ROI manifests in three key areas: First, labor cost reduction by automating reconciliation and audit processes. Second, capital efficiency improvement through faster settlement cycles, freeing up working capital. Third, risk and compliance cost avoidance by providing an immutable, transparent audit trail for regulators. For example, a global trade finance network using blockchain reduced document processing times from 5-10 days to under 24 hours, slashing administrative costs by an estimated 50-80%.

Implementation requires careful planning. The challenge isn't the technology itself, but orchestrating ecosystem adoption and agreeing on shared data standards with partners. The solution is to start with a consortium model for a specific, high-friction process—like provenance tracking or invoice financing—where the ROI of trust and automation is clear to all involved. This focused approach builds the business case for broader integration, turning a cost center into a strategic asset.

Digital Identity for KYC/AML Compliance

Enables customers to own and control a reusable, verifiable digital identity. Financial institutions share attestations without exposing raw data, cutting Know Your Customer (KYC) onboarding costs.

  • Reduces per-customer onboarding cost from ~$50 to under $5.
  • Cuts compliance review time from weeks to minutes.
  • Pilot Example: The Monetary Authority of Singapore's (MAS) Project Veritas demonstrated 80% efficiency gains in risk assessment.
05

Asset Tokenization for Capital Efficiency

Converts physical assets (real estate, invoices, funds) into digital tokens on a blockchain. This unlocks liquidity and streamlines administrative overhead.

  • Reduces settlement and custodial fees by automating ownership records and dividend distributions.
  • Enables fractional ownership, expanding the investor base.
  • Example: The Hong Kong Monetary Authority's Project Genesis issued the first tokenized green bond, simplifying issuance and compliance.
